Transaction 52542df6a631a80e694af8f49c73cf8f047128d4e0050ecbbc069e577fb32996

1 Input
2 Outputs
  • 52542df6a631a80e694af8f49c73cf8f047128d4e0050ecbbc069e577fb32996:0
  • value  233139
    address  3CHsR8DxUFiN6BPToLKwj8xtNhQRu2zZ1q
  • 52542df6a631a80e694af8f49c73cf8f047128d4e0050ecbbc069e577fb32996:1
  • value  369262
    address  3HgRV8djgA7srLdAxVPdsFapp2rXULGCfx